Re: The World Ending?
No, they were betting on:
1) The quantity and quality of their nuclear arsenal being sufficient to deter the other nation from launching the first attack and
2) In the case of an actual exchange; the speed, accuracy and co-ordination of their delivery system being better than the opposing side's, hence they can remove all necessary military, production and infrastructure targets quicker and better than the enemy can, and in such a way that the enemy's delivery system will be severely hampered.
Luckily for the world, the first point acted both ways.
